As nouns, score is a hypernym of par; that is, score is a word with a broader meaning than par:
  • par: (golf) the standard number of strokes set for each hole on a golf course, or for the entire course
  • score: a number that expresses the accomplishment of a team or an individual in a game or contest
As verbs, score is a hypernym of par; that is, score is a word with a broader meaning than par:
  • par: make a score (on a hole) equal to par
  • score: gain points in a game
